Mercedes Reviews

Mercedes-Benz is one of, if not the, oldest surviving automakers in the world. Founded in 1881, the first Mercedes automobile was created in 1886. The German company is now operated by Daimler-Benz and headquartered in Stuttgart, Germany. In addition to producing automobiles, Mercedes-Benz also makes commercial trucks and buses in Europe.
